Fortin is no different than draftees I've seen go for 3.5m. He'd be a candidate to be overvalued by particular teams (mostly Chinese?) who put tremendous stock in the 'elastic effect' due to his 7 OD/PAS/JR and total skill count. It's no guarantee he'd go for much more than 2m, though.

Breton is very nice as well, but would require a more hands-on fine tuning in future seasons. He's not nearly as sexy to purchase. 900k-1.4m+ maybe. Dunno.

It's probably advisable to pony up and get a level 5 (superior) trainer with an affordable weekly salary if you don't already have one. Expensive but worth it for these guys, especially if you decide to train Fortin.
